Spotlight Athlete: Lauren Adkins
The Lake Howell junior volleyball player is one of the top players in the state and is helping the Silver Hawks achieve the same accolades.
Adkins, an outside hitter, picked up where she left off in 2008. As a sophomore she racked up 334 kills, 119 digs, and 30 blocks earning her All State-Honorable Mention honors, on the way to a 5A runner-up finish.
In 2009, the 5'11 junior is proving to be just as dominant. She led the way in the team's OVA tournament win this past weekend and picked up 21 kills and four blocks Tuesday night in a sweep against Seminole County rival Oviedo. Through 12 matches her stat line is incredible, 202 kills, 123 digs, and nine blocks.
Although just a junior, she is receiving interest from some of the top volleyball programs in the country including two SEC powers, Florida and Georgia.
